Switzerland granted 38 million soms to 23 municipalities of Kyrgyzstan to help them to improve living conditions of people

Representatives of 23 municipalities of Osh and Naryn provinces were awarded grant certificates in the amount of KGS 38 million at the ceremony held on March 23, 2018, in Bishkek. The grants will be used to solve priority issues identified by the citizens, such as construction of kindergartens and improvement of water services.

Switzerland and Kyrgyzstan launched a new project to improve health of the population in Kyrgyzstan

Today, on March 6, 2018, the Ambassador of Switzerland to the Kyrgyz Republic Mrs. Véronique Hulmann and the Minister of Health of the Kyrgyz Republic, Mr. Talantbek Batyraliev signed an agreement for a four-year project aiming at improving the prevention and management of non-communicable diseases.

IFC Helps Advance Digital Finance in Central Asia

Almaty, Kazakhstan, February 28, 2018—IFC, a member of the World Bank Group, is hosting today a regional conference to promote digital financial services, including e-money, Internet and mobile banking in Central Asia. The event is part of a larger World Bank Group effort to help people and small businesses access financial services, which is key to combating poverty and driving economic growth.

University of Central Asia and Stockholm School of Economics in Riga Sign Agreement of Cooperation

The University of Central Asia (UCA) and the Stockholm School of Economics in Riga (SSE Riga) signed a memorandum of understanding on 14 February 2018 in Riga, Latvia. The intended areas of cooperation include development of curriculum for UCA’s undergraduate programme in Economics, faculty and student exchanges as well as research cooperation.
